Conventional toothbrushes have no medicinal properties in and of themselves;
It has been said that you should always apply toothpaste when brushing your teeth. Therefore, if a toothbrush itself could be endowed with various medicinal effects, brushing the teeth would become unnecessary and would be extremely convenient. However, it has been difficult to impart medicinal efficacy to toothbrush brushes and to maintain the medicinal efficacy stably for a long period of time. Furthermore, it has been difficult to achieve safety in terms of safety, such as non-carcinogenicity and non-inflammation and allergy-inducing properties.

Therefore, it is an object of the present invention to provide a toothbrush that has medicinal effects in itself, lasts for a long time, and is safe.

この発明における多糖類としては、キチン、キ

る。 The polysaccharide used in this invention is preferably one or two of chitin, chitosan, cellulose, dextran, agarose, starch, and the like.
Porous materials derived from chitosan and potato starch are particularly effective. Examples of these derivatives include ion-exchangeable derivatives, derivatives with hydrophobic groups, and tannin-bonded fusion products.

で、各種薬剤の固定化能が高い。 To produce a porous substance from a polysaccharide or its derivative, for example, chitosan is produced by dissolving low molecular weight chitosan in an acidic solution, and dropping this solution into a basic solution to coagulate it into granules. The granular porous chitosan thus obtained has a uniform particle size, uniform micropores, and a large specific surface area, so it has a high ability to immobilize various drugs.

15 μm and a specific surface area of 2 to 5 m 2 /g) or a mixture with a synthetic resin such as nylon is extruded from a molding machine into a thread shape to a wire diameter of about 25 μm.

共有結合である。 Next, the brush thus produced is impregnated with a drug, and the drug is fixed in the porous material. Examples of drugs include water-soluble azulene to prevent alveolar pyorrhea, chlorhexidine gluconate to prevent dental plaque and bad breath, vitamin E to strengthen the gums, and astringents. Immobilization means include physical adsorption and covalent bonding by functional groups (amino group, carboxyl group, hydroxyl group, imidazole group, phenol group, sulfhydryl group, etc.).

ルギーを引き起すことはない。 In the toothbrush constructed as described above, the drug is separated and released from the porous material during use.
Maintains stable medicinal efficacy for a long time. Furthermore, since the porous material uses naturally derived polymers such as polysaccharides, it does not induce cancer or cause oral inflammation or allergies.
